KEY CONCEPTS & GIST OF THE LESSON v   Life processes – The processes that are necessary for an organism to stay alive. Eg. Nutrition, respiration, etc. v   Criteria of life - (i) Growth  (ii) Movement v   Nutrition - The process in which an organism takes in food, utilizes it to get energy, for growth, repair and maintenance, etc. and excretes the waste materials from the body. v   Types of nutrition                                                                           1.        Autotrophic nutrition (Auto =self:  trophos = nourishment) E.g. Plants, Algae, blue green bacteria. o    Process – Photosynthesis(Photo=light; Synthesis= to combine) o    Raw materials- (i) Carbon dioxide (ii)Water o    Equation-                   sunlight                                                                           o     6CO 2   +  6H 2 O                                     C 6 H 12 O 6      +     6O 2                                        Chlorophyll o    Energy

Topics discussed in the class X (1-20th July, 2015)

Chapter Life Processes Revision of Nutrition , Respiration Circulatory System in Humans :Significance of circulatory system, Structure of human heart , No of chambers in heart of fish, amphibia, reptiles birds and mammals, Blood flow through heart, Single/ Double circulation, Presence of valves and their function, Types of Blood vessels , Arteries vs Veins, capillaries, Blood components, Blood pressure, Lymph - formation and function. Transport in Plants : Vascular Tissues:  Xylem and Phloem, Transport in xylem due to root pressure and transpirational pull, Transport in phloem- Translocation.
